Richard Zepeda Obituary

Richard Zepeda Richard Zepeda, 21, of Exeter passed away Friday, February 8, 2013. Richard Zepeda, you were the first born angel given to us by our Father God. Though he has chosen you to serve him in Heaven as Faithful Disciple for his next mission, his decision has left all your loved ones with broken hearts and pain that cannot be relieved. We will always carry you in our hearts and your way of caring has really touched everybody's heart and you will always be remembered as loving, caring, faithful, honest, very dependable, very hard worker, always outsmarted everyone and you showed your appreciation with your unique "Blink and a Smile". You were a loving father…. A loving son.. and a loving big brother that would never be forgotten by his loving Mother and Father, brothers and sisters, your aunt Isabel, uncles, cousins, grand parents and friends. Love and Pain Forever… We Love You and will Always be Missed. Visitation will be held 4-7 p.m. Monday, February 18, 2013 at Salser and Dillard Funeral Chapel. A rosary will be held at 6 PM on Monday, February 18, 2013 at Salser and Dillard Funeral Chapel. A mass will be held at 9 AM on Tuesday, February 19, 2013 at St. Frances Cabrini in Woodlake. Burial at Exeter District Cemetery. Condolences may be e-mailed to [email protected]

To plant trees in memory, please visit the Sympathy Store.

Published by Visalia Times-Delta and Tulare Adv-Register on Feb. 16, 2013.
